8 37 Agenda Item Meeting Report Agenda Item: 94/10-12 Item 5 Subject: Highways Meeting Date: 8 th October 2012 Item Owner/Holder: Mr John Audsley Decision Type: Report Non Key Classification Unrestricted Purpose of Report: Highways Report Recommendation: For information and discussion London beach junction We are advised that the formal Public Consultation starts today, 8th October. I am not yet clear whether the proposed closure of Oak Grove Lane is included in this Consultation. I think We as a Parish Council are going to handle this. How will we ensure all Parishioners know about it? How will we formulate our response? Even, do we as a PC have an agreed position? There has been a lot of publicity in the local press but we need to step up awareness of the proposals. A plan of action is needed. Speedwatch After seemingly endless delays the scheme is off the ground. A group of nine willing and enthusiastic volunteers received their training from the Kent Police civilian officer responsible for the scheme in Kent. By the time of this meeting we will have held three roadside sessions measuring the speed of passing traffic. We have not had many speeding motorists but we have seen many "dippers" ie drivers who slow down as soon as they see us. I am told that this should've seen as a sign of success. We have the equipment on loan until 18th October so hope to run 3 more sessions before then. I am very grateful to the volunteers who share the PC's concerns about the risks of serious accidents in the village. Drains Some drains have been cleared and the rest are included in the countywide programme. That means a long wait probably. However if we can identify a specific area where drains need attention, they will give that priority. Traffic Island Streetlights There are now 3 broken Streetlights along the A28. I reported them some weeks ago and after chasing Highways they tell me they will treat each broken light as a separate project, each requiring a separate licence to install traffic lights to facilitate the repairs. The first one should start in a few weeks time. One street light has been replaced opposite the entrance to Hopes Grove Pedestrian Crossing We were offered a meeting about a possible crossing in early August. I have been told we could have expected to receive a reply about this 2 weeks ago but at the time of writing this report none has arrived. I would like to discuss how to proceed with this at the meeting
